It may be an esoteric point, but it bears emphasis:

A university cannot be involved in NIL.

Donors can decide to place money into a charitable foundation. They can use student athletes to advertise or represent their brand or products. That brand, however, cannot be the school nor its departments directly.

I'm nor naive enough to think that an AD wouldn't ask a donor to redirect his "gift" to an NIL appropriate source off the record or similar. However, with present rules in place, the university itself cannot officially direct a NIL deal.
